Specifications
| Spec | GMWD Dual-Station Smith Machine Power Cage, | JX FITNESS Home Gym SCM-1148L |
|---|---|---|
| Weight Stacks | 121LB | 148LB |
| Exercises | 100+ | 20+ |
| Material | Strength Steel | Thick Steel |
| Adjustability | Fully Adjustable | Limited |
| Installation | Complex | Easy |

Overview of the GMWD Dual-Station Smith Machine Power Cage and Home Gym SCM-1148L
The GMWD Dual-Station Smith Machine Power Cage is a comprehensive home gym system designed for versatile workouts, while the Home Gym SCM-1148L offers multifunctional capabilities at a lower price point. The GMWD machine sells for $1,019.99, making it about 89% more expensive than the SCM-1148L, priced at $539.00. Both products cater to home fitness enthusiasts but target different training needs and budgets.
Design and Build Quality
The GMWD Dual-Station Smith Machine boasts a heavy-duty grade structure made of strength steel, ensuring stability during intense workouts. This design is crucial for serious lifters who require durable equipment. In contrast, the Home Gym SCM-1148L, constructed from high-quality thick steel, promises to handle various weight challenges but is less specialized in its structural integrity for heavy lifting compared to GMWD.
Functionality
The GMWD machine is designed to support over 100 exercises, making it a truly multifunctional workout station. It features independent 121LB weight stacks for dual users, allowing different exercises without interference. On the other hand, the Home Gym SCM-1148L also offers a range of exercises but is primarily focused on full-body workouts. While it allows for decent versatility, it may not match the extensive capabilities of the GMWD machine.
User Experience
In terms of user experience, the GMWD Dual-Station Smith Machine provides a fully adjustable setup with seating, backrests, and pulleys that adapt to various body types. This ensures comfort and targeted muscle engagement for all users. The Home Gym SCM-1148L promotes ease of use with its easy installation process, supported by detailed instructions and a tutorial video. However, its adjustability features may not be as comprehensive as those found in the GMWD machine, potentially limiting individualized workouts.
Price Comparison
When it comes to pricing, the GMWD Dual-Station Smith Machine is priced at $1,019.99, significantly higher than the Home Gym SCM-1148L at $539.00. This price difference of approximately 89% reflects the advanced features and dual-user capacity of the GMWD machine. For budget-conscious consumers or those new to home workouts, the SCM-1148L may present a more attractive option without compromising essential functionality.
Target Audience
The GMWD Dual-Station Smith Machine is ideal for couples or training partners looking to perform different exercises simultaneously. Its design caters to serious fitness enthusiasts who require a robust and versatile machine for strength training. Conversely, the Home Gym SCM-1148L targets a broader audience, including beginners or those seeking a compact solution for comprehensive workouts. With its lower price and ease of assembly, it appeals to those who prioritize convenience and affordability.
Sales Performance
In terms of sales rank, the Home Gym SCM-1148L performs remarkably well, holding a bestseller rank of 11,753, while the GMWD Dual-Station Smith Machine ranks at 81,889. This indicates that the SCM-1148L has gained more traction among consumers, likely due to its competitive pricing and easier accessibility for those entering the fitness space.
